Sacred Heart-Griffin's tournament run continued when they took on Rock Island on Monday. The Sacred Heart-Griffin Cyclones fell 65-55 to the Rock Island Rocks. While losing is never fun, the Cyclones can't take it too hard given the team's big disadvantage in MaxPreps' Illinois basketball rankings (they are ranked 163rd, while the Rocks are ranked tenth).
Sacred Heart-Griffin's defeat dropped their record down to 7-6. As for Rock Island, their victory bumped their record up to 13-1.
Both squads are looking forward to the support of their home crowds in their upcoming games. Sacred Heart-Griffin will host Quincy Notre Dame at 7:00 p.m. on Friday. As for Rock Island, they will be playing at home against DeKalb at 7:00 p.m. on Friday.
